草庐IT

python - 将平面列表转换为python中的列表列表

人们可能想做与扁平化列表相反的事情,likehere:我想知道如何将平面列表转换为列表列表。在numpy中,您可以执行以下操作:>>>a=numpy.arange(9)>>>a.reshape(3,3)>>>aarray([[0,1,2],[3,4,5],[6,7,8]])我想知道你是如何做到相反的,我通常的解决方案是:>>>Mylist['a','b','c','d','e','f']>>>newList=[]foriinrange(0,len(Mylist),2):...newList.append(Mylist[i],Mylist[i+1])>>>newList[['a','b'

python - 将平面列表转换为python中的列表列表

人们可能想做与扁平化列表相反的事情,likehere:我想知道如何将平面列表转换为列表列表。在numpy中,您可以执行以下操作:>>>a=numpy.arange(9)>>>a.reshape(3,3)>>>aarray([[0,1,2],[3,4,5],[6,7,8]])我想知道你是如何做到相反的,我通常的解决方案是:>>>Mylist['a','b','c','d','e','f']>>>newList=[]foriinrange(0,len(Mylist),2):...newList.append(Mylist[i],Mylist[i+1])>>>newList[['a','b'

空间中两个平面求交线

欢迎关注更多精彩关注我,学习常用算法与数据结构,一题多解,降维打击。话题:给出2个平面方程,求解交线方程A1x+B1y+C1z+D1=0A_1x+B_1y+C_1z+D_1=0A1​x+B1​y+C1​z+D1​=0A2x+B2y+C2z+D2=0A_2x+B_2y+C_2z+D_2=0A2​x+B2​y+C2​z+D2​=0基本思路一条直线可以用以下形式表示P=O+t⋅DP=O+t·DP=O+t⋅DO为直线上一点,D为方向向量O为直线上一点,D为方向向量O为直线上一点,D为方向向量对于两个平面,只要确定D和O就可以确定这条交线。就可以将问题分解成两个子问题:求解直线方向向量求解交线上一点求解

Matlab 点云最小二乘法拟合平面(剔除噪声)

生活中只有两个悲剧:一个是没有得到你想要的,另外一个是得到了你想要的。----王尔德文章目录一、简介二、实现代码三、实现效果参考资料一、简介这个算法的思路很简单,就是通过剔除一些异常点来拟合更为合适的平面,具体过程如下所示:1、首先使用最小二乘法拟合一个平面系数的初值。2、计算所有有效点到拟合平面的距离did_id

【计算机网络 - 第四章】网络层:数据平面

目录一、网络层概述1、主要作用2、控制平面方法3、网络层提供的两种服务二、路由器工作原理1、路由器总体结构2、输入、输出端口处理(1)输入端口(2)输出端口3、交换(1)经内存交换(2)经总线交换(3)经互联网络交换 4、排队问题(1)输入排队、输出排队(2)分组调度三、网际协议:IPv4、寻址、IPv6及其他1、IPv4数据报格式2、IPv4数据报分片(1)基本概念(2)IP数据报分片例题3、划分子网的IPv4地址(1)分类(2)分类编址习题 (3)子网和子网掩码2、无分类编址的IPv4地址(1)CIDR无分类域间路由选择(2)路由聚合(构造超网)3、主机如何获得IP地址? (1)动态主机配

线结构光三维重建(二)相机标定、光平面标定

线结构光三维重建(一)https://blog.csdn.net/beyond951/article/details/125771158                上文主要对线激光的三角测量原理、光平面的标定方法和激光条纹提取的方法进行了一个简单的介绍,本文则主要针对线激光三维重建系统的系统参数标定进行阐述,同时对采集到的图片进行标定。本文主要涉及到的几个重难点:相机标定、激光条纹提取、光平面的标定和坐标系变换的理解。相机标定        本博客有多篇文章详细阐述了相机标定的理论推导过程,可详细参考下面链接文章的推导和实现。北邮鲁鹏老师三维重建课程之相机标定https://blog.cs

AR Engine毫秒级平面检测,带来更准确的呈现效果

近年来,AR版块成为时下大热,这是一种将现实环境中不存在的虚拟物体融合到真实环境里的技术,用户借助显示设备可以拥有真实的感官体验。AR的应用场景十分广泛,涉及娱乐、社交、广告、购物、教育等领域:AR可以让游戏更具互动性;商品通过AR展示更真实;使用AR进行教育教学让抽象事物更形象等,可以说AR技术已经渗透人们生活的方方面面。为了让人们产生强烈的视觉真实感,AR首先要解决的问题就是如何将虚拟对象准确地融合到现实世界中,即让虚拟对象以正确的姿态显示在真实场景的正确位置上。一些AR方案完成环境识别与摄像机位姿计算之后,没有进行平面检测就直接叠加虚拟对象显示,导致虚拟对象与真实环境没有很好的贴合度,用

3Dslicer医学图像三维坐标系(xyz,RAS,IJK)差异,转换,旋转,平面角

目录Worldcoordinatesystem世界坐标系xyzAnatomicalcoordinatesystem解剖学坐标系(LPS/RAS/RAI)Imagecoordinatesystem图像坐标系ijkImagetransformation图像转换三维坐标变换A.旋转矩阵和旋转向量B.欧拉角C.四元数​编辑计算平面角AnglePlanes插件参考链接处理医学图像和应用程序时的问题之一是坐标系之间的差异。成像应用中常用三种坐标系:xyz是世界坐标系RAS是解剖坐标系,单位mmIJK是像素/体素坐标系,单位像素pixel/体素voxel世界(xyz轴)                解剖学

PCL 平面点云边界点按顺/逆时针排序(方法一)

目录一、算法原理二、代码实现三、结果展示四、参考链接一、算法原理  已知多边形点集C=P1,P2,...,PiC={P_1,P_2,...,P_i}

python - 将 "list of tuples"转换为平面列表或矩阵

使用Sqlite,select..from命令会返回结果output,它会打印:>>printoutput[(12.2817,12.2817),(0,0),(8.52,8.52)]这似乎是一个元组列表。我想将output转换为一个简单的列表:[12.2817,12.2817,0,0,8.52,8.52]或2x3矩阵:12.281712.2817008.528.52通过output[i][j]读取flatten命令对第一个选项不起作用,我不知道第二个...我们将不胜感激快速的解决方案,因为实际数据要大得多。 最佳答案 迄今为止发布的最